[Php-avanzado] Proyecto final ajustes
Leonardo Tadei - Pegasus Tech Supply
leonardot en pegasusnet.com.ar
Mie Jul 24 01:40:40 ART 2013
Hola Daniel,
Sé que te va a hinchar un poco hacer esto, pero creeme que tiene muchos
beneficios a la larga!
Te pongo como ejemplo como sería la redacción de las cosas poniendo sus
dependencias bien organizadas:
1) El sistema debe gestionar Provincias.
2) El sistema debe gestionar Localidades con su Provincia [1]
3) El sistema debe gestionar Clientes con su Localidad [2] y su
Provincia [1]
...
De esta forma, queda organizado por sus dependencias funcionales, ya
que la Provincia existe por sí sola, la Localidad necesita de la
Provincia, y el Cliente necesita de ambas, tal como se explicita.
Esto implica tener un diccionario para Provincia, otro para Localidad,
y otro para Cliente.
Se entiende? Y así para cada cosa!
Dejás varias cosas que te planteo en el mail anterior sin resolver:
- las marcas
- los rubros
- los modelos
- los tipos en la especificación- el material
- si un cliente tiene muchos accesos o un acceso tiene muchos clientes.
- la relación funcional entre los artículos y la especificación.
- hay una o varias listas de precios?
No entiendo que querés decir con "La lista de precio no se gestionan
solo se proyectan" : cómo hacés para proyectar algo que no se puede
cargar? Me aclararía mucho este tema saber si hay una sola lista de
precios o varias.
Seguimos!
PD: pensá en lo que hace esto (cómo funciona) y no en las tablas que
tenga algún sistema que hayas hecho anteriormente sobre este tema!!!
> Proyecto consulta artículos mayorista :
>
> El sistema debe... gestionar cliente
> El sistema debe... gestionar clientes con su localidad y su provincia
> El sistema debe... gestionar accesos
> El sistema debe... gestionar privilegios
> El sistema debe... gestionar artículos
> El sistema debe... proyectar precios según su nivel de acceso
> El sistema debe... proyectar artículos
>
>
> diccionario:
> Los clientes tienen:
> Nombre
> Apellido
> Dirección
> Piso
> Departamento
> Telefono
> Numero fax
> Email
> Comercio
>
>
> Los accesos tienen:
> Usuario
> Contraseña
> Cliente
> Privilegio
> Generan consulta o mensaje
>
> Los privilegios tienen:
> estado
> nivel de precio
>
> El estado tiene:
> activo
> pendiente
>
> Movimientos de visitas guardan:
> fecha
> hora
> cliente
>
>
> Los articulos tiene:
> codigo
> descripcion
> marca
> modelo
> rubro
> precio
> imagenes
>
> Los artículos tienen una especificación
> tipo
> material
> medidas
> cantidad
> bultos x caja
>
>
> Los precios tienen:
> listas
> precio
>
>
> La lista de precio no se gestionan solo se proyectan
>
>
> _______________________________________________
> Php-avanzado mailing list
> Php-avanzado en pato2.fi.mdp.edu.ar
> http://www3.fi.mdp.edu.ar/cgi-bin/mailman/listinfo/php-avanzado
>
--
Leonardo Tadei
leonardot en pegasusnet.com.ar
Web: http://leonardo.tadei.com.ar
Firma pública: http://www.pegasusnet.com.ar/LeonardoTadei-public.key
Más información sobre la lista de distribución Php-avanzado